About FLiiP: FLiiP is revolutionizing fitness business management through our all-in-one SaaS platform. As a seed-stage startup, we've recently raised over 4 million CAD and are scaling rapidly, aiming to 4x our growth over the next two years. We serve gyms, yoga studios, martial arts centers, and other fitness businesses with a powerful suite of software solutions that streamline operations and improve customer management. At FLiiP, we embrace the new era of AI and automation. We're not just adopting tools, we're building a culture of 10x execution.

We experiment constantly to leapfrog bottlenecks, streamline manual workflows, and focus our time on what drives outcomes. Whether it's AI agents, enrichment tools, or no-code automations, we're always seeking new ways to deliver more value to our customers with less overhead. Role Overview: We are looking for a Senior Growth Marketing Manager who is hands-on, data-driven, and obsessed with experimentation. This is a founding Growth Marketing role, joining at the seed stage. The ideal candidate is a strong individual contributor who thrives in testing and iterating rapidly to unlock scalable growth opportunities.

You will work directly with the Chief Growth Officer, owning paid media channels, running structured growth experiments, and bridging marketing attribution gaps across both digital and offline channels. You will also be responsible for overseeing external freelancers and vendors. This is a 100% remote role, based in Canada.
